I want to install a PT100 into a bearing antifrition

(OP)
hello everybody, I`m electric guy, learning something on bearings, I´d to install a PT100 into a old bearing, I wanna know what`s the distance from the antifriction layer to put the head of my PT100, and what could be the real temperature diference between my reading and the real one.

RTDs (PT-100) and thermocouples are installed in sleeve type journal bearings all the time.  The distance from the antifriction (babbitt) surface depends on the diameter of the hole for the PT-100.  If the distance is too small the babbitt will "dimple" (form a depression) or fail.  Typical minimum babbitt thicknesses for different hole diameters are as follows:
Hole Diam: 0.250 inch     Min. Thickness: 0.080 inch
Hole Diam: 0.375 inch     Min. Thickness: 0.130 inch
Hole Diam: 0.500 inch     Min. Thickness: 0.180 inch

I can't tell you what the difference from the actual difference will be, but as I mentioned above, this type of installation is very common.  I actually prefer "tip-sensitive" thermocouples for faster response.

The following tips will improve the quality of the installation and measurement:

1. Use a "flat bottom" (rather than "pointed") drill bit to make the hole.

2. Make sure the tip of the RTD or thermocouple is in contact with the babbitt. (Spring-loading works best).

3. Purchase a "tip-sensitive" RTD or thermocouple.

4. Be careful about grounding (earthing).  If the tip is grounded do not ground the sheath at the opposite end.
